Anticipating scenarios to avoid surprises
Planning ahead is essential to the success of any Black Friday strategy, and that includes implementing staff on demand. Carrying out a prior analysis of operational needs, understanding the expected demand peaks, and calculating the exact amount of staff required are crucial steps for an efficient operation.
The earlier your company starts preparing, the easier it will be to ensure that the right professionals are available and ready to act. By conducting a detailed analysis of your operational needs and preparing in advance, you avoid unpleasant surprises and can align the training of new temporary staff so that they are ready to contribute at the moment of peak demand.

Reinforcing inventory management and logistics
One of the greatest challenges during Black Friday is inventory management. Companies need to ensure that products are available and that there are no stockouts. With a temporary team focused on inventory management and restocking, your company can avoid delays, ensure product availability, and maximize sales.
Agility in order processing and shipping
With the increase in sales volume, order processing can become a bottleneck. Staff on demand allows companies to reinforce their shipping and processing areas, ensuring that orders are sent out quickly, which results in greater customer satisfaction and fewer complaints.

Reducing wait times in customer service
During Black Friday, the increase in customer flow can create long service queues. With the reinforcement of staff on demand, your company can reduce wait times both in physical stores and across digital channels, delivering faster, more effective service.
Ensuring post-sales support
Once sales have been made, post-sales support is crucial. During Black Friday, this can be a challenge if the team is insufficient to handle the volume of demand. Staff on demand can be allocated to reinforce post-sales service, resolving issues quickly and avoiding customer dissatisfaction.
